Deathwoods: The Ultimate Slasher Experience
The premise of this film taps into a primal fear that has haunted audiences for decades. We are talking about the quintessential setting: a secluded campsite where help is miles away and the phone lines are definitely cut. When you strip away the modern comforts of technology, you are left with the raw, terrifying reality of a masked figure standing between you and survival.
The Wallace family tragedy serves as the narrative anchor for this chaos. What began as a local legend has transformed into an active nightmare for those daring enough to visit the site of the original gruesome murder-suicide. The lore is rich, detailed, and deeply unsettling, promising more than just simple jump scares.

The Psychology of Modern Horror
Why do you crave the thrill of being scared? Science suggests that controlled exposure to fear can actually provide a stress-relieving release. When you sit in the dark and watch a character struggle to survive, your body reacts with a surge of adrenaline, followed by a sense of relief when you realize you are safe on your couch.
This, of course, is the goal of any high-quality slasher. It manipulates your biology. It forces you to sympathize with the protagonists, only to dismantle their chances one by one. The masked killer represents the unknown, a figure devoid of empathy or logic, which is perhaps the most frightening thing of all.
